### Key Ceremony Checklist — Item 6 (Gridscope Plugin Signing)

Plugin authors for Gridscope, our GPU memory profiling suite, must verify the signing key escrow before publishing. Confirm both custodians are present, the sealed token is intact, and the ceremony log is countersigned. When the escrow terminal prompts, enter the recovery passphrase shown below.

unlock words, hahip-baduf: holwyn-istath-julvan

## Runbook: Pointvault loyalty-ledger reconciliation

Before approving a manual ledger adjustment, confirm the request carries dual sign-off and that the affected account shows no open fraud hold. All adjustments are append-only; never edit prior entries. For audit purposes, each reconciliation run must cite the signed build it executed against, recorded immediately below.

session token of fahap-hawip = htk31_7852f2b3276dba2738f98fa97f92237

**Handover: string extraction script**

The `lingcomb` script pulls translatable strings from the Bramblewick UI and pushes them to the localization bundle. It must run before every release cut; skipping it ships stale translations. Known quirk: pluralized keys need the `--expand` flag. Full context, edge cases, and run history now transfer to the new owner.

account owner for bawip-tahag: Raleth Quenok

Hey — handover for the Pondglass GraphQL N+1 fix before I head out.

Short version: the `orders → lineItems` resolver was firing one DB query per item, so big merchants saw 400+ queries per request. I added a batching dataloader with a per-request cache; latency dropped ~70% on staging. Two gotchas for new folks: the loader cache is request-scoped (don't make it global), and batch size matters a lot. Tuning lives in the service config, not code. Current production values are below.

service settings:
[oliix]
team = noveth
access_code = ac_4de949
host = oliix.novachq.corp
port = 8080
owner = wenir.casion
peer = wenys.lumicstack.corp